Repealing the pit bull ban

Monday, September 26th, 2005

Looks like Upper Marlboro, MD is looking to repeal its ban on politically incorrect dogs: “Public policy should make sense,” said Councilman Thomas R. Hendershot. “It shouldn’t be overly expensive, and it ought to be fair. The pit bull ban is none of the above.” The county captures and boards about 1,000 pit bulls annually, […]

More pit bull bans

Friday, November 5th, 2004

This time in Israel: The law’s regulations determine for the first time a list of breeds that may not be imported and those already here must be neutered by the end of the year. The Ministry of Agriculture is expecting that breeds such as the Rottweiler, the Amstaff and the Pit Bull will vanish from […]

Canada’s pit bull ban

Monday, October 18th, 2004

Noting that the Humane Societies are against breed specific legislation, critics of the proposed dog ban in Canada are calling the proposal unworkable for the reasons I’ve outlined here before: Mr. Roney said that because pit bulls are cross-breeds, Canadian and American kennel associations don’t recognize them as an individual breed. “Most casual observers can’t […]
